ABSTRACT OF THE DISCLOSURE A circuit for use in a dispatching system operable to efficiently direct the movement of customers, vehicles or other dispatched units arranged in a waiting line to two sets of serving or receiving stations, such as banks, airline ticket terminals, store check-out counters, and other applications, the system includes actuating means at each set of serving stations for producing electrical request signals and two electrically actuated instructing means, preferably direction indicating signs, for directing movement to an associated set of serving stations. The circuit effects actuation of each instructing means in response to a request signal produced by actuating means at its associated set of serving stations, and effects alternate actuation of both instructing means in response to simultaneous storage of request signals produced by actuating means at both sets of serving stations.
